FRIDAY, 18TH MAY 2018 is Kindness Day SG. It was inaugurated in 2013 as an occasion for Singaporeans to come together in celebration of kindness and graciousness. It is to inspire one another and transform our society into a nation of kindness. This day is celebrated as a day for showing appreciation to one another, with the iconic symbol of the yellow gerbera.

Over the years, many informal and self-organised groups have approached SKM to seek support for their self-initiated voluntary projects. These groups are affectionately called the Ground-up Movements (GUM). Their projects promote the message of kindness to different communities or address more specific social issues.
